
Installing plastic fender rivets can be a challenging task. While some rivets can be pushed in with your thumb, others may require the use of a rubber hammer or specific tools such as a rivet gun or pliers. Depending on the type of rivet, you may need to insert them into the fender hole and use a tool to pull or twist the stem until it breaks off. Some rivets have center push pins that can be removed, allowing the rivet to be twisted out. It is important to note that certain rivets are designed to be used once and may require replacement if they become distorted during removal. When installing plastic fender rivets, it is crucial to ensure a tight and secure fit to avoid any issues.

Using a rubber hammer to tap them in
Plastic fender rivets can be installed using a rubber hammer. This method is useful when the rivets cannot be pushed in with your thumb. When using a rubber hammer, it is important to tap them in very gently, as applying too much force can cause the rivets to break.
To begin the installation process, ensure that the plastic rivets are correctly positioned in the fender hole. Hold them in place with one hand, and use the rubber hammer with the other hand to gently tap the rivets into the hole. It is important to apply light pressure and avoid excessive force.
The rubber hammer provides a gentle tapping action that prevents damage to the plastic rivets. Its soft and flexible nature makes it ideal for this task, reducing the risk of breakage or deformation. The rubber material absorbs some of the impact forces, resulting in a softer blow compared to a traditional metal hammer.
When tapping the rivets, aim for the centre of the rivet head. This will ensure that the force is evenly distributed, allowing the rivet to be securely locked in place. By gently tapping the rivets, you can gradually increase their depth in the hole until they are firmly seated.
Using a rubber hammer to install plastic fender rivets is a straightforward process. It requires a gentle touch and attention to detail. With careful execution, you can successfully install the rivets without causing any damage.

Using a rivet gun
To install plastic fender rivets using a rivet gun, first place the rivet in the fender trim hole. Then, push the rivet gun onto the rivet and squeeze the trigger. This will cause the rivet to pop into place, and the stem will fall out when you turn the tool over. It may take two pulls of the rivet gun to break the rivet shaft, and you may need to cut off any remaining nub with a pair of wire cutters.
You can also use a rivet gun to remove rivets. To do this, place the rivet in the gun and squeeze the trigger twice. This will cause the rivet shaft to pop off, allowing you to remove the rivet.
Some people may prefer to install plastic fender rivets manually, without the use of a rivet gun. This can be done by breaking or trimming off the long part of the rivet, pushing the remaining bit of plastic out of the rivet with a small object, pushing the rivet into the fender hole, and then inserting the long piece back into the rivet. However, this method may require more force than using a rivet gun.

Some rivets use a centre push pin to flare the inside open. Pull the centre pin out and then twist the rivet out. For the non-centre pin version, use needle-nose pliers to pry them out.
Some rivets can be removed with a rivet tool, but others need to be broken to be removed. You can also try using a pick or a very small object to push the remaining plastic out of the rivet.
